• <br /> • <br /> • <br /> • <br /> • <br /> • SECTION 4.0 <br /> • Activities Completed during the Reporting <br /> • Period <br /> • <br /> • <br /> • <br /> • This section describes activities completed during the current reporting period; <br /> groundwater sampling;annual tree survey;10-year evaluation soil sampling;and former <br /> • bagging plan investigation soil and groundwater sampling. Operations and maintenance <br /> • activities (e.g.,tree pruning and maintaining the irrigation system) are performed on a <br /> • regular basis,but are not routinely reported unless the activities could affect the <br /> performance of phytoremediation.The objectives of the activities completed during the <br /> • reporting period were as follows: <br /> • • To collect groundwater samples to evaluate the effectiveness of phytoremediation in <br /> • removing nitrogen from groundwater <br /> • • To evaluate the overall health of the planting areas <br /> • . To collect soil samples to evaluate the effectiveness of phytoremediation in removing <br /> • nitrogen from soil <br /> • • To collect soil and groundwater samples at the former bagging plant,to evaluate if a <br /> • nitrate source area exists around monitoring well KP-3 and to define its extent <br /> • 4.1 Groundwater Sampling <br /> • <br /> • As specified in MRP No.R5-2004-0835 (Water Board,2004b),semiannual groundwater <br /> sampling of newly installed wells will be conducted for the first year after well installation,- <br /> thus <br /> nstallation;thus a semiannual groundwater sampling event was performed on March 4,2011.Depth to <br /> • groundwater was measured at all monitoring wells and samples were collected from the <br /> • wells installed in 2010 (KP-10S-R and KP-4D).The annual groundwater sampling event was <br /> performed on August 9 to 11,in accordance with MRP No.R5-2004-0835 (Water Board, <br /> • 2004b).Monitoring wells KP-7S,KP-7D,and KP-9S were not located during the annual <br /> • event because they were covered with 2 to 9 inches of road base,despite searching for them <br /> • using two metal detectors.Monitoring well KP-8S was not able to be accessed because it <br /> was behind a locked gate.These four wells are located west of the site on the property <br /> • owned by the Port of Stockton.During the next sampling event,survey stakes will be <br /> • considered for the monitoring wells located in the Port of Stockton area in an attempt to <br /> protect them from heavy equipment traffic and regular grading of the ground surface. In <br /> • addition,a global positioning system unit may be used to aid in locating monitoring wells <br /> • that are covered by road base. <br /> • As part of the annual groundwater sampling event,monitoring well KP-3 was video <br /> • surveyed;the video survey is presented in Appendix F. The results of the semiannual and <br /> annual groundwater monitoring events are presented in Section 5.The semiannual and <br /> • annual groundwater field reports are presented in Appendix C. <br /> • <br /> • RDD1112370001(CAH5003.DOCx) 4-1 <br /> • <br /> • <br /> • <br />
